Output bb9e59e0eb012d0c88300d948909891d1e7f0783e4717914eec9c799c053c065:0

value
22382669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96e00e9cfe1074b8f2a7ae4dc3aa958278fe993c OP_EQUAL
address
3FSmh5SWeKEXarwYdkhBuqTcum9zWEX61Y
transaction
bb9e59e0eb012d0c88300d948909891d1e7f0783e4717914eec9c799c053c065
confirmations
132159
spent
true